diff --git a/roles/autosigner/tasks/main.yml b/roles/autosigner/tasks/main.yml index 367f47a2be..0947e81dde 100644 --- a/roles/autosigner/tasks/main.yml +++ b/roles/autosigner/tasks/main.yml @@ -4,7 +4,7 @@ with_items: - sigul - # fedora-packager is required for /etc/koji/$arch-config +# fedora-packager is required for /etc/koji/$arch-config - name: install dependencies yum: state=installed pkg={{ item }} with_items: @@ -12,3 +12,17 @@ - fedmsg-hub - fedora-packager - python-fedmsg-meta-fedora-infrastructure + +# sigul config for secondary archs: +# https://fedoraproject.org/wiki/Sigul_Client_Setup_SOP +- name: sigul config koji instances + ini_file: dest=/etc/sigul/client.conf section=koji option=koji-instances + value="arm ppc s390" + +- name: sigul config koji config + ini_file: dest=/etc/sigul/client.conf section=koji + option=koji-config-{{ item }} value="/etc/koji/{{ item }}-config" + with_items: + - arm + - ppc + - s390